Plato, MO vs Ravenwood, MO
The cost of living difference between Plato, MO and Ravenwood, MO is dramatic. Ravenwood is 43.9% cheaper than Plato,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Plato has a cost index of 84 while Ravenwood sits at 58,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.
When it comes to buying, median home values in Plato are $146,700 compared to $70,000 in Ravenwood, a 110% gap.
Median household income in Plato is $57,750 compared to $56,500 in Ravenwood (+2.2%). Plato does offer higher incomes, but the salary premium barely offsets the higher cost of living, leaving residents with a tighter budget.
